Sony’s Spectacular Spider-Man Spectacle

Sony’s pulling out all the stops with their latest trailer, reminding us why Spidey has captured our hearts for generations. From Tobey Maguire’s classic portrayal to Andrew Garfield’s edgier take, and finally to Tom Holland’s youthful charm, this trailer has it all. It’s like a Spidey buffet, serving up every flavor of your favorite web-slinger. And let’s not forget the epic team-up in “Spider-Man: No Way Home.” It’s a fan’s dream come true!

But wait, there’s more! Sony isn’t just stopping at a trailer. They’re giving us the ultimate movie marathon, with each film premiering one week apart. It’s a Spider-Man extravaganza, spanning decades of cinematic history. Whether you’re a fan of the classic Tobey Maguire films or prefer the modern twist of Tom Holland’s Spider-Man, there’s something for everyone. So mark your calendars because April 15th is just around the corner, and you won’t want to miss this web-slinging adventure!

Sony’s Struggles in the Spider-Verse

While Sony is basking in the glory of Spider-Man’s return to theaters, not everything is sunshine and spider-webs in the world of Sony’s Marvel Universe. Their attempt at creating a cinematic universe outside of the MCU has been met with mixed reviews, to say the least. With flops like “Madame Web” failing to impress both critics and audiences alike, it seems like Sony’s Spidey spin-offs are struggling to find their footing.

Despite their efforts, the Sony Universe of Marvel Characters (SUMC) has been plagued by financial woes and creative missteps. And with stars like Dakota Johnson openly mocking their own films, it’s clear that all is not well in Sony’s Spider-Verse. Perhaps it’s time for Sony to rethink their strategy and focus on what they do best: bringing Spider-Man to life on the big screen.

The Legacy of Sam Raimi’s Spider-Man

Ah, Sam Raimi’s Spider-Man trilogy. For many fans, these films defined their childhood and set the standard for superhero movies to come. Tobey Maguire’s portrayal of Peter Parker was nothing short of iconic, and who could forget that unforgettable upside-down kiss with Kirsten Dunst’s Mary Jane?

But it wasn’t just the characters that made these films special; it was the heart and soul that Sam Raimi poured into every frame. From the exhilarating action sequences to the tender moments of romance, Raimi captured the essence of Spider-Man like no other director before him. And let’s not forget the unforgettable performances from Willem Dafoe as the Green Goblin and Alfred Molina as Doctor Octopus.

So as we gear up for the return of all eight live-action Spider-Man films, let’s take a moment to appreciate the legacy of Sam Raimi’s trilogy. Without his vision and passion, we wouldn’t be swinging into theaters next month to relive the magic all over again. So thank you, Sam Raimi, for giving us the Spider-Man we never knew we needed.
